| General Area of Operations
Our general area of operations extends along the East side of Vancouver Island between Campbell River and Port Hardy including Desolation Sound and all the Islands and the Mainland Inlets. This area is considered as the "ultimate boaters' paradise" by many mariners who frequent these waters during the summer. Good weather, calm and protected waters, unique scenery and tremendous saltwater angling attract a large boating community from the Seattle and Vancouver areas each year. The "Inside Passage" is also transited by many boaters heading to B.C.'s North Coast and further on to Alaska.
